Phi Kappa Tau is proud of its affiliation with SeriousFun Children's Network (formerly the Association of Hole in the Wall Camps) established by the late Paul Newman, Ohio ’43. Camps across the country and around the world are special places designed to provide a healthy dose of laughter and enjoyment for children with serious illnesses. Each year, Phi Tau undergraduates and alumni volunteer their time at camps, serving as positive male role models for the children.

A gift to the SeriousFun Stipend Fund directly supports Brother Paul Newman’s camps. These restricted dollars directly provide travel stipends for Phi Kappa Tau members who volunteer at a camp.
